Job description

Job Details

Job Location: Kikkoman Foods Inc HQ and Walworth Plant - Walworth, WI 53184

Job Shift: Second Shift

Summary: As an instrumentation technician, you will test, calibrate, install, repair, and inspect manufacturing equipment and monitoring devices. You'll also perform general maintenance on the equipment and design new measuring and recording equipment.

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Repair and maintenance of electrical and process control systems for a highly automated food processing facility, to operate in the safest and most productive condition, supporting continuous improvement and reliability of equipment and building systems
  • Possess the ability to troubleshooting 480 systems
  • Installation, repair, calibration, and maintenance of instrumentation used in process controls, analyzing systems, valves/actuators, and other pneumatically controlled devices
  • Determines causes for malfunctioning instruments and takes appropriate action to improve system reliability
  • Variable frequency drive programming and troubleshooting
  • Reads and interprets electrical blueprints, schematics, P&ID and loop drawings
  • Performs preventive maintenance on instrumentation & electrical equipment
  • Working as part of a team but would routinely perform work independently and maintain a high level of accuracy and safety, while performing your duties
  • Assists in the implementation and improvement of effective preventive maintenance programs for equipment and facilities
  • Generate and maintain written procedures for maintenance tasks
  • Follows all applicable good manufacturing practices (GMP's).
  • Executes and documents planned and unplanned work via maintenance management system
  • Leverages methodologies like root cause analysis to identify and resolve equipment issues
  • Assists in the maintenance of parts inventory
  • Plan maintenance work with operations, contractors, and other plant staff
  • “Call in” duties as requested by Maintenance supervision
  • Depending on the situation, mechanical maintenance work may be required.
  • Mentorship/training as needed
  • Other duties as assigned
